Laser Technician 3 – Non-Exempt - 2nd Shift

Hanwha Aerospace USA has long been recognized as a leader in the development and supply of flight critical Aerospace/Defense components and assemblies. Operating out of four state-of-the-art facilities located in Connecticut. Hanwha Aerospace USA offers growth and career development opportunities to enrich your talents.

As a member of the Coatings Department at Hanwha Aerospace USA, a Laser Technician will perform a of variety of critical, difficult and extensive laser machining operations along with appropriate setups related to standard and non-standard customer orders under the direction of the Laser Supervisor or assigned Lead Person.

Location: Based out of East Windsor, CT

Reports to: Laser Supervisor

Shift: 2nd Shift

Essential Duties & Responsibilities:

  • Develop Laser parameters, procedures and fixture for new Laser operations.
  • Prepare the necessary metallurgical specimens to determine recast layer characteristics.
  • Perform dimensional layout and critical machine set ups.
  • Ability to operate all in-house Laser equipment.
  • Perform troubleshooting and assist in technical tasks as required or assigned.
  • Align and secure holding fixtures, attachments, accessories onto machines.
  • Clean and prepare all detail materials for Laser processing.
  • Position and fasten work pieces onto holding fixtures.
  • Select predetermined settings specific to each Laser machine and individual job.
  • Measure, examine, and test completed units in order to detect defects and ensure conformance to specifications, using precision instruments such as micrometers
  • Maintain records and document in process inspection data as required
  • Work with a variety of materials, including steel and non-metallic
  • Observe and listen to operating machines or equipment in order to diagnose machine malfunctions and to determine need for adjustments or repairs.
  • Perform basic machine maintenance as required to maintain part quality and quantity standards.
  • Clean and lubricate machines, tools, and equipment in order to remove grease, rust, stains, and foreign matter.
  • Operate equipment to verify operational efficiency.
  • Assist and instruct and aid lower level Laser Technicians with related operations as required.
  • Monitor the departmental activities of the lower level Laser Technicians.
  • Take corrective action at the appropriate levels.
  • Report faulty or unusual conditions to the appropriate level of supervision.
  • Ensure that safety and housekeeping standards are met.

Requirements:

  • Must have 3-5 years’ experience
  • Basic reading, writing and some advanced arithmetic skills.
  • Ability to read and interpret blueprints and part specifications.
  • Knowledge of metal characteristics.
  • Knowledge of 5 axis laser is a plus
  • Ability to set up and operate Laser equipment the appropriate fixtures and accessories.
  • Ability to use standard measuring tools such as micrometers, calipers and gauges.
  • Manual dexterity required for operating machinery and computers.
